The Pandora-Gilboa Rockets will face off against the Hardin Northern Polar Bears at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day. Pandora-Gilboa has a tough task ahead: they'll enter the match with 14 straight losses, while Hardin Northern will come in with four straight victories.
On Wednesday, Pandora-Gilboa came up short against Arcadia and fell 6-1.
Pandora-Gilboa sa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was G Kempf, who went 1-for-2 with one stolen base.
Meanwhile, Hardin Northern was not the first on the board on Tuesday, but they got there more often. They were the clear victors by a 12-2 margin over Ridgemont. Considering the Polar Bears have won six games by more than five runs this season, Tuesday's blowout was nothing new.
Hardin Northern's win bumped their record up to 10-2. As for Pandora-Gilboa, their defeat dropped their record down to 0-13.
